Being a mother is hard work enough...
Being the mother of a mentally ill child is unfathomable to those who have never been there.
Our oldest son, almost 17, has a severe mental illness that has rocked our world upside down and sideways for over a decade. We live each day strapped into a new rollercoaster....not sure how long that days ride will last.
My hope is that by sharing our experiences and how we have coped we will assist and support other families living a similar life with the necessary tools and resources to give their child the highest quality life possible and make it through to the end of each day never feeling alone.
